The Importance of Timing in Relationships

Timing plays a crucial role in the success of any relationship. Whether it’s a romantic confession, an apology, or a declaration of love, the moment in which these sentiments are expressed can make all the difference. Here are a few key points to consider regarding the importance of timing in relationships:

1. **Emotional Readiness**: Both parties need to be emotionally prepared to receive and reciprocate feelings. If one person is preoccupied with personal issues or is not in the right mindset, a confession may fall flat or lead to misunderstandings.

2. **Context Matters**: The surrounding circumstances can greatly influence how a confession is perceived. For instance, confessing feelings during a moment of celebration can lead to joy, while doing so during a crisis may be met with resistance or distraction.

3. **Building Trust**: Timing is also about building trust and rapport. A well-timed confession can strengthen a bond, while a poorly timed one may create distance. Zende’s experience illustrates how crucial it is to gauge the emotional climate before making such bold declarations.

4. **The Ripple Effect**: A confession can have a ripple effect on relationships. Zende’s admission not only affected his relationship with the person he confessed to but also impacted those around them. This interconnectedness highlights the need for careful consideration before expressing deep feelings.
